		<description><![CDATA[University of Tennessee Health Science Center
The University of Tennessee Health Science Center lives up to its motto “improving the health of Tennesseans” by producing various competent medical professionals. The UTHSC has extensive training programs and excellent medical facilities to equip its students with competence in giving medical and health services. UTHSC provides high quality instruction and training to students ranging from the field of dentistry to nursing to medicine proper. The University of Tennessee Health Science Center was launched in Memphis in 1911, specializing only in health science education and research. 		<description><![CDATA[Robert Wood Johnson Medical School
The Robert Wood Johnson Medical School is part of the University of Medicine and Dentistry in New Jersey. Robert Wood Johnson Medical School or RWJMS is among the best places where students can enjoy excellent training programs in medicine and healthcare. Students who study in RWJMS will have the opportunity to conduct research at the Center for Advanced Biotechnology and the New Jersey Stem Cell Institute, the first state-funded stem cell institute. 		<description><![CDATA[The University of Washington Medical School was establed in 1946. Under Dean Edward Turner, offices and classrooms were located within huts on campus and at the King County Hospital. During the next decades, the University of Washington Medical School expanded, attracting plenty of brilliant faculty members and students. Among its notable alumni are Nobel laureates Linda Buck, George Hitchings, and Martin Rodbell.
